What is an example of a square root function? In (,) form

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 04-03-2021

Step-by-step explanation:

The parent function of the functions of the form f(x)=√x−a+b is f(x)=√x . Note that the domain of f(x)=√x is x≥0 and the range is y≥0 . The graph of f(x)=√x−a+b can be obtained by translating the graph of f(x)=√x to a units to the right and then b units up.
